Fujifilm A100 vs Nikon L24 Overview

On this page, we are comparing the Fujifilm A100 versus Nikon L24, both Small Sensor Compact cameras by manufacturers FujiFilm and Nikon. There is a noticeable difference among the resolutions of the Fujifilm A100 (10MP) and L24 (14MP) but both cameras posses the same sensor sizes (1/2.3").

Apple Innovates by Creating Next-Level Optical Stabilization for iPhone

The Fujifilm A100 was unveiled 24 months prior to the L24 making them a generation apart from each other. Both cameras have the same body design (Compact).

Fujifilm A100 vs Nikon L24 Physical Comparison

In case you're aiming to lug around your camera regularly, you should factor in its weight and volume. The Fujifilm A100 comes with outer measurements of 92mm x 61mm x 22mm (3.6" x 2.4" x 0.9") with a weight of 124 grams (0.27 lbs) while the Nikon L24 has sizing of 98mm x 61mm x 28mm (3.9" x 2.4" x 1.1") and a weight of 182 grams (0.40 lbs).

Fujifilm A100 vs Nikon L24 Sensor Comparison

Often, it is hard to picture the contrast in sensor measurements just by viewing specifications. The graphic underneath will give you a greater sense of the sensor sizing in the Fujifilm A100 and L24.

To sum up, both of the cameras provide the same sensor dimensions but different MP. You can expect to see the Nikon L24 to provide you with extra detail having an extra 4 Megapixels. Greater resolution can also help you crop images more aggressively. The older Fujifilm A100 will be disadvantaged in sensor technology.
